persistentstorage/centralrepository/test/testexecute/SWI/pma_data/dosis.bat
author hgs
Tue, 19 Oct 2010 16:26:13 +0100
changeset 55 44f437012c90
permissions -rw-r--r--
201041_01
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
55
44f437012c90 201041_01
hgs
parents:
diff changeset
     1
@echo off
44f437012c90 201041_01
hgs
parents:
diff changeset
     2
rem
44f437012c90 201041_01
hgs
parents:
diff changeset
     3
rem Copyright (c) 2010 Nokia Corporation and/or its subsidiary(-ies).
44f437012c90 201041_01
hgs
parents:
diff changeset
     4
rem All rights reserved.
44f437012c90 201041_01
hgs
parents:
diff changeset
     5
rem This component and the accompanying materials are made available
44f437012c90 201041_01
hgs
parents:
diff changeset
     6
rem under the terms of "Eclipse Public License v1.0"
44f437012c90 201041_01
hgs
parents:
diff changeset
     7
rem which accompanies this distribution, and is available
44f437012c90 201041_01
hgs
parents:
diff changeset
     8
rem at the URL "http://www.eclipse.org/legal/epl-v10.html".
44f437012c90 201041_01
hgs
parents:
diff changeset
     9
rem
44f437012c90 201041_01
hgs
parents:
diff changeset
    10
rem Initial Contributors:
44f437012c90 201041_01
hgs
parents:
diff changeset
    11
rem Nokia Corporation - initial contribution.
44f437012c90 201041_01
hgs
parents:
diff changeset
    12
rem
44f437012c90 201041_01
hgs
parents:
diff changeset
    13
rem Contributors:
44f437012c90 201041_01
hgs
parents:
diff changeset
    14
rem
44f437012c90 201041_01
hgs
parents:
diff changeset
    15
rem Description:
44f437012c90 201041_01
hgs
parents:
diff changeset
    16
rem
44f437012c90 201041_01
hgs
parents:
diff changeset
    17
@echo on
44f437012c90 201041_01
hgs
parents:
diff changeset
    18
44f437012c90 201041_01
hgs
parents:
diff changeset
    19
@if not exist "%1" md "%1"
44f437012c90 201041_01
hgs
parents:
diff changeset
    20
@if not exist "%1" goto :InvalidFolder
44f437012c90 201041_01
hgs
parents:
diff changeset
    21
@if not exist "%2" goto :MissingCert
44f437012c90 201041_01
hgs
parents:
diff changeset
    22
@if not exist "%3" goto :MissingKey
44f437012c90 201041_01
hgs
parents:
diff changeset
    23
44f437012c90 201041_01
hgs
parents:
diff changeset
    24
44f437012c90 201041_01
hgs
parents:
diff changeset
    25
makesis KS401.pkg KS401.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    26
signsis -S KS401.sis KS401s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    27
makesis KP401.pkg KP401.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    28
signsis -S KP401.sis KP401s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    29
makesis KS402.pkg KS402.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    30
signsis -S KS402.sis KS402s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    31
makesis KP402.pkg KP402.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    32
signsis -S KP402.sis KP402s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    33
makesis KS403.pkg KS403.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    34
signsis -S KS403.sis KS403s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    35
makesis KP403.pkg KP403.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    36
signsis -S KP403.sis KP403s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    37
makesis KS404.pkg KS404.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    38
signsis -S KS404.sis KS404s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    39
makesis KP404.pkg KP404.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    40
signsis -S KP404.sis KP404s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    41
makesis KS405.pkg KS405.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    42
signsis -S KS405.sis KS405s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    43
makesis KP405.pkg KP405.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    44
signsis -S KP405.sis KP405s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    45
makesis KS406.pkg KS406.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    46
signsis -S KS406.sis KS406s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    47
makesis KP406.pkg KP406.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    48
signsis -S KP406.sis KP406s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    49
makesis KS407.pkg KS407.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    50
signsis -S KS407.sis KS407s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    51
makesis KP407.pkg KP407.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    52
signsis -S KP407.sis KP407s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    53
makesis KS411.pkg KS411.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    54
signsis -S KS411.sis KS411s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    55
makesis KP411.pkg KP411.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    56
signsis -S KP411.sis KP411s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    57
makesis KS412.pkg KS412.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    58
signsis -S KS412.sis KS412s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    59
makesis KP412.pkg KP412.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    60
signsis -S KP412.sis KP412s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    61
makesis KS413.pkg KS413.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    62
signsis -S KS413.sis KS413s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    63
makesis KP413.pkg KP413.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    64
signsis -S KP413.sis KP413s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    65
makesis KS414.pkg KS414.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    66
signsis -S KS414.sis KS414s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    67
makesis KP414.pkg KP414.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    68
signsis -S KP414.sis KP414s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    69
makesis KS415.pkg KS415.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    70
signsis -S KS415.sis KS415s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    71
makesis KP415.pkg KP415.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    72
signsis -S KP415.sis KP415s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    73
makesis KS416.pkg KS416.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    74
signsis -S KS416.sis KS416s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    75
makesis KP416.pkg KP416.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    76
signsis -S KP416.sis KP416s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    77
makesis KS417.pkg KS417.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    78
signsis -S KS417.sis KS417s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    79
makesis KP417.pkg KP417.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    80
signsis -S KP417.sis KP417s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    81
makesis KS421.pkg KS421.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    82
signsis -S KS421.sis KS421s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    83
makesis KP421.pkg KP421.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    84
signsis -S KP421.sis KP421s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    85
makesis KS422.pkg KS422.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    86
signsis -S KS422.sis KS422s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    87
makesis KP422.pkg KP422.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    88
signsis -S KP422.sis KP422s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    89
makesis KS423.pkg KS423.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    90
signsis -S KS423.sis KS423s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    91
makesis KP423.pkg KP423.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    92
signsis -S KP423.sis KP423s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    93
makesis KS431.pkg KS431.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    94
signsis -S KS431.sis KS431s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    95
makesis KP431.pkg KP431.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    96
signsis -S KP431.sis KP431s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    97
makesis KS432.pkg KS432.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
    98
signsis -S KS432.sis KS432s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
    99
makesis KP432.pkg KP432.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
   100
signsis -S KP432.sis KP432s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
   101
makesis KS433.pkg KS433.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
   102
signsis -S KS433.sis KS433s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
   103
makesis KP433.pkg KP433.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
   104
signsis -S KP433.sis KP433s.sis %2 %3
44f437012c90 201041_01
hgs
parents:
diff changeset
   105
44f437012c90 201041_01
hgs
parents:
diff changeset
   106
44f437012c90 201041_01
hgs
parents:
diff changeset
   107
echo f | XCOPY /fry *.sis %1\
44f437012c90 201041_01
hgs
parents:
diff changeset
   108
del /f *.sis
44f437012c90 201041_01
hgs
parents:
diff changeset
   109
@goto :EOF
44f437012c90 201041_01
hgs
parents:
diff changeset
   110
44f437012c90 201041_01
hgs
parents:
diff changeset
   111
:InvalidFolder
44f437012c90 201041_01
hgs
parents:
diff changeset
   112
@echo ERROR: Can't create folder %1
44f437012c90 201041_01
hgs
parents:
diff changeset
   113
@goto :EOF
44f437012c90 201041_01
hgs
parents:
diff changeset
   114
44f437012c90 201041_01
hgs
parents:
diff changeset
   115
:MissingCert
44f437012c90 201041_01
hgs
parents:
diff changeset
   116
@echo ERROR: Missing certificate %2
44f437012c90 201041_01
hgs
parents:
diff changeset
   117
@goto :EOF
44f437012c90 201041_01
hgs
parents:
diff changeset
   118
44f437012c90 201041_01
hgs
parents:
diff changeset
   119
:MissingKey
44f437012c90 201041_01
hgs
parents:
diff changeset
   120
@echo ERROR: Missing certificate key %3
44f437012c90 201041_01
hgs
parents:
diff changeset
   121
@goto :EOF